Appropriate Preposition:

  • Allot to ( বিলি করা ) One room has been allotted to him.
  • Esteem for ( শ্রদ্ধা ) He has esteem for the superiors.
  • Beware of ( সতর্ক হওয়া ) Beware of pick-pockets.
  • Faith in ( বিশ্বাস ) I have no faith in him.
  • Think over ( চিন্তা করা (কোনকিছু) ) Think carefully over his advice.
  • Devoid of ( বর্জিত ) He is devoid of common sense.

Idioms:

  • To and fro ( এদিন-ওদিক ) Being unable to make up his mind the man is walking to and fro.
  • Far and wide ( সর্বত্র ) His fame as a scholar spread far and wide
  • Red letter day ( স্মরণীয় দিন ) The 21 February is a red letter day in the history of Bangladesh.
  • By the by ( প্রসঙ্গক্রমে ) By the by I came to know that he was ill.
  • Man of letters ( পন্ডিত লোক ) Sir Ashutosh Mukherjee was a man of letters.
  • In force ( বলবৎ ) This law is in force now.
